For non-destructive image editing, never use "Image -> Adjustments", instead, use "Layer -> New Adjustment layer" ...
That way you are not altering any pixels on the original image, but rather, adding an adjustment layer on top of it.
Also, use layer masking as much as possible when making image edits.
